Understanding Sash Windows

Before diving into finding a repairman, it's important to comprehend what sash windows are and the common problems they deal with:

Common Issues with Sash Windows

IssueDescription
DraftsTriggered by gaps in the frame, causing energy loss.
Sticking SashesWood can swell from moisture, causing trouble in opening.
Broken CordsCords that hold the weights can break, leading to non-functioning sashes.
Rotting WoodWater damage can lead to wood rot and wear and tear.
Fogging or Broken GlassDouble-glazed sashes can establish fogging between panes or have fractures.

Understanding these typical problems assists in interacting efficiently with a repair technician and makes sure informed decision-making.

Frequently Asked Questions About Sash Window Repairs

1. How much does it cost to repair sash windows?The cost can vary substantially based upon the degree of the repairs needed. Usually, minor repairs can range from ₤ 100 to ₤ 300, while extensive remediations may cost ₤ 500 or more.

2. For how long do sash window repairs take?The period depends upon the complexity of the repairs. An easy repair could take a couple of hours, while more substantial work may need several days.

3. Can I repair my sash windows myself?While some minor concerns can be attended to by homeowners, it's suggested to work with an expert for more complicated repairs to avoid further damage.

4. How can I maintain my sash windows?Routine maintenance, consisting of cleaning the tracks, checking for draft leakages, and repainting or sealing wood, can help lengthen the life of your sash windows.
